Disproving the Misconception of Brushing Harder for Cleanser Teeth



Don't think the myth that brushing harder will certainly result in cleaner teeth. Many people believe that using more pressure while brushing will eliminate extra plaque and bacteria from their teeth. Nevertheless, this isn't real, and as a matter of fact, it can be harmful to your dental health and wellness.

Brushing as well hard can damage your tooth enamel and aggravate your gums, leading to sensitivity and gum tissue economic downturn. cheap dentists near me to effective cleaning isn't compel, yet strategy and uniformity.

It's advised to use a soft-bristled tooth brush and mild, circular activities to cleanse all surface areas of your teeth. Furthermore, brushing for root canal price of two mins two times a day, along with regular flossing and oral exams, is vital for preserving a healthy smile.

Common Dental Myths: What You Need to Know



Do not be misleaded by the myth that sugar is the primary culprit behind tooth decay and tooth cavities.

While it's true that sugar can add to dental troubles, it isn't the single cause.



Dental caries happens when hazardous bacteria in your mouth feed upon the sugars and starches from the foods you consume.

These bacteria generate acids that wear down the enamel, bring about tooth cavities.

Nonetheless, inadequate dental health, such as inadequate brushing and flossing, plays a significant function in the development of tooth decay also.

In addition, certain variables like genes, completely dry mouth, and acidic foods can also add to oral issues.
